SAN JOSE, Calif. _ ``I'm just looking to make it right.''
In a rare telephone interview, Pearl Jam singer Eddie Vedder is talking about the illness that forced him off the stage in June, just six songs into a set in front of 50,000 people at San Francisco's Golden Gate Park.
In one of those surprising stream-of-consciousness moments that endear him to those who know him well, Vedder has called a reporter to talk about radio and Pearl Jam's commitment to broadcasting possibly illegally, during its visit to San Jose this weekend. He is responding to a column in last week's San Jose Mercury News praising the band for bringing 1960s idealism back to life.
